BISHOP, Texas (Tennis) – The 2014-15 regular season finale is here and Texas A&M University-Kingsville (12-10, 1-1 LSC) hosts conference rival Tarleton State University (6-7, 0-2 LSC) on April 18 at 1 p.m. at the Bishop High School Tennis Courts.
Â
The match was originally scheduled for Friday, April 17, but inclement weather in the South Texas area has not cooperated.
Â
The Hogs are coming off back-to-back wins over nationally-ranked Cameron University and regionally-ranked Southern Nazarene University.
Â
Ranked No. 8 in the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) South Central Region,
Mariaxi Herrera is ranked No. 11 in singles with an 11-8 overall record in singles No. 1 and she and
Marija Dimitrovska are 13-9 in doubles No. 1 (duo is ranked No. 8 in region). On the year,
Erika Larrea is 13-4, tied for the most wins on the team with
Paula Saenz. Dimitrovska is 10-9 overall giving the Javelinas four student-athletes in double figures.
Â
In doubles action,
Nadia Grlj and
Tabata Lua are 10-11 and Larrea and Saenz have nine wins.
Â
For TSU, Luiza Ferraro-Adas is 9-2 in singles play and Ashleigh Elward follows at 8-4. The tandem of Ariadna Cabezas-Mart and Erika Richarme is 10-2 in doubles this season with nine wins coming in No. 3. Richarme is 6-6 in 2015 and enters the weekend ranked No. 16 in the South Central region. Â
Â
Following Saturday's match, both teams head to Lawton, Okla. for the 2015 LSC Championships hosted by Cameron.
